How much does it cost to fly with the Blue Angels?

It breaks down to $10,487 per hour per plane. The figure matches up with fuel consumption rates for the Boeing F/A-18 Super Hornet E/F, the current Navy warplane adapted for the Blue Angels. There are six Super Hornets in each show, so you could calculate fuel costs for a one-hour flight at about $62,000.

How often do the Blue Angels fly?

60 shows annuallyThe Blue Angels typically perform aerial displays in at least 60 shows annually at 30 locations throughout the United States and two shows at one location in Canada.

How much does a Blue Angels show cost?

Civilian sponsors of air shows pay a $6,000 fee per show day, Dietlin said. The Blue Angels will perform three shows at the Fleet Week Air Show, one each between 12:30 p.m and 4 p.m. on Friday, Saturday and Sunday, putting the total fee at $18,000.

Where are the Blue Angels located?

The world-famous Blue Angels are based at NAS Pensacola, and can be seen practicing over the Museum at NAS Pensacola select days throughout the year. Practice times vary so check the schedule below prior to planning your visit. Practices last about 55 minutes, and admission to is FREE and open to individuals with valid DoD ID card access.

How many pilots are in the Blue Angels?

Sixteen officer pilots between the Navy and the Marines serve with the Blue Angels. Also, over a hundred enlisted service members between the two branches support the pilots.
